Acle Train Station, while compact, is well-equipped to facilitate a smooth traveling experience. Even though it lacks a formal ticket office, passengers can easily access ticket machines to collect tickets, including those purchased online. These machines are fully accessible, making it simple for everyone to manage their travel documentation with ease.
For added convenience, passengers seeking information can use the station’s help point. Customer information is available through departure screens and announcements, ensuring that travelers remain updated on their journeys. Although the station does not offer luggage storage or lost property services, passengers can rest assured with CCTV surveillance enhancing station security.
Step-free access is available for part of the journey through Acle Train Station. This is especially useful for travelers heading towards Great Yarmouth as there is direct step-free access from the car park to Platform 2. Those wishing to travel towards Norwich have to navigate a stepped footbridge, but alternatively, an access path from Reedham Road is available, though it spans approximately 250 meters. Passengers needing assistance can rely on the Passenger Assist service, providing comprehensive help for onward journeys with prior booking.
Rail replacement buses are conveniently stationed in front of the nearby police station on Norwich Road, providing an alternative travel option when necessary. With an eye to comfort and convenience, the station offers a robust array of facilities. The ticket office is open daily from 5:00 AM to just before midnight, ensuring no traveler is left without assistance. Accessibility is a primary focus here, with step-free access available throughout the station, including to the platforms and the ticket office. While ticket machines are accessible to everyone, at this time the station does not offer smartcards, though you can conveniently collect tickets purchased online at the machine.
While you won't find a dedicated waiting room, there's ample seating, and assistance is available throughout the week to provide support when needed. If you're in need of some last-minute shopping or currency exchange, the station hosts a variety of shops, including ATMs and currency exchange services. However, bear in mind that refreshment facilities are not available within the station itself.
The airport's connectivity extends to the station's varied transportation links. Taxis are readily available at the airport terminals to whisk you to your next destination. For those inclined towards public transportation, National Rail services connect you to London Paddington, alongside National Express coaches that serve key destinations such as Victoria Coach Station and Gatwick Airport. The London Underground's Piccadilly Line also integrates seamlessly with this hub, providing a convenient metro option.
